Safeguarding Adults Lead
Role Overview & Responsibilities
This role is a key part of the senior corporate leadership team and is highly specialised. The post holder will be expected to support teams with day-to-day complex safeguarding decision making including the provision of advice, supervision, professional development, and training. This role is pivotal in providing assurance to and the Trust external partners of highly quality safeguarding practice within the Trust.
The Safeguarding Adults Lead will be responsible for overseeing safeguarding quality improvements, within the current legislative framework and anticipate new statutory responsibilities They will closely with the Head of Clinical Services and the Senior Corporate Nursing Leads and across the Integrated Care System to ensure support for all safeguarding activities.
